Re: Do You Have Your Child Get Their Flu Shot?
Posted by eroxgirl From now on, I'll make sure I give my kids ONLY the shot and not the mist. The one time my kids took the mist, my DD got the flu anyway. She really didn't like breathing in the mist.
This year (not sure if its a permanent change), the mist is not being offered. The CDC did studies last year and found that the mist was found to be no different in terms of effectiveness than not getting vaccinated at all. Only shots now.
